Test report on 6' x 16' 6-ply India Aero Cushion Tyres fitted to a Bentley.

To Hs{Lord Ernest Hives - Chair}/Rm.{William Robotham - Chief Engineer} x1336 HS{Lord Ernest Hives - Chair}/FD.{Frank Dodd - Bodies} &KW.19.9.35. 6" x 16" - 6-ply India Aero Cushion Tyres. We have tested a set of the above tyres on the Bentley with very pleasing results. The test was carried out on a Bentley with fixed damper loads, and the tyre pressures set to 25 lbs/sq.in. recommended by the makers. There is a marked improvement in the ride of the car, very noticeable over the Oamaston Park Road. The steering is not affected at speed, it was thought that the joggles were slightly more noticeable, but this is a question for other opinions. The steering is slightly heavier to handle, but is comparable with the standard Bentley. We propose leaving these wheels and tyres on the car to get further experience.
